Home Insurers Should Raise Deductible: Study
NU Online News Service, Sept. 14, 1:37 p.m. EDT?Home insurers should require higher deductibles and increase their loss prevention efforts to alleviate affordability problems for the line, an insurance association report suggests.[@@]
The study, titled "How to Solve the HO Availability/Affordability Crisis," was written by Bill Wilson, director of the Big "I" Virtual University. VU is an online insurance educational and informational resource program offered by the Independent Insurance Agents & Brokers of America, based in Alexandria, Va.
